3873 nh Image$15.00 2005 Hunting Permit, Souvenir Sheet, Artist Signed in Gold (RW72b var). Mint N.H., couple minor bends

VERY FINE. A RARE SOUVENIR SHEET SIGNED BY THE ARTIST IN GOLD. APPROXIMATELY 100 EXAMPLES WERE SIGNED IN THIS COLOR.

1,000 souvenir sheets were printed and sold for $20.00 each. Of those, approximately 750 were in black, 150 in blue and 100 in gold. This is the first example we have offered in gold (Image)
